The interactions of nanomaterials and nanosystems within bio systems are a concern for all the scientific community. Several groups are working on addressing the issues related to nanosafety and nanotoxicity, but these assessments cannot accurately be made without addressing and defining the unique parameters of nanomaterials. Advances in Characterization Techniques for Nanotoxicology is a collection of chapters addressing the physical assessment of nanomaterials and the link between the nanomaterials properties and observed biological effects. The book conists of chapters from distinguished scientists working in this field from many different countries.
